Earned vs Unearned Income - Difference Earned income is simply the monetary compensation you receive in exchange for labor or services. It is subject to payroll tax and federal and state income tax. On the contrary, unearned income is the money you receive without actively … Foreign Unearned Income Earned Income: If you are a sole proprietor or partner and your personal services are also an important part of producing the income, the part of the income that represents the value of your personal services will be treated as earned …

Distinguishing Between Earned Income & Investment Income ... Certain types of income don't fit into the category of earned income or investment income. For example, Social Security benefits, unemployment benefits, alimony, child support and gambling winnings are not earned and do not arise from making investments. UNEARNED INCOME - dhs.state.mn.us
